User 대량 생성
- 인쇄
- PDF
User 대량 생성
- 인쇄
- PDF
기사 요약
이 요약이 도움이 되었나요?
의견을 보내 주셔서 감사합니다.
User를 대량으로 생성합니다.
요청
- POST /users/bulk
요청 Body
{
"params": [
{
"loginId": "string",
"description": "string",
"userProfile": {
"firstName": "string",
"lastName": "string",
"email": "string",
"empNo": "string",
"phoneCountryCode": "string",
"phoneNo": "string",
"deptName": "string"
},
"accessRules": {
"consoleAccessAllowed": "boolean",
"apiAccessAllowed": "boolean"
}
}
]
}
파라미터 | 필수 여부 | 타입 | 설명 | 제약사항 |
---|---|---|---|---|
params.[].loginId | Y | String | 로그인 아이디 | email 형식 |
params.[].description | N | String | 유저 설명 | 최대 300 bytes |
params.[].userProfile | N | Object | User profile | |
params.[].userProfile.firstName | N | String | 이름 | 최대 200 bytes |
params.[].userProfile.lastName | N | String | 성 | 최대 200 bytes |
params.[].userProfile.email | N | String | 이메일 | 최대 200 bytes, email 형식 |
params.[].userProfile.empNo | N | String | 사원 번호 | 최대 200 bytes |
params.[].userProfile.phoneCountryCode | N | String | 핸드폰 번호 국가 번호 | 최대 10 bytes, 국가 번호 형식만 허용 |
params.[].userProfile.phoneNo | N | String | 핸드폰 번호 | 최대 200 bytes, 핸드폰 번호 형식만 허용 |
params.[].userProfile.deptName | N | String | 부서명 | 최대 200 bytes |
params.[].accessRules | Y | Object | 접근 규칙 | |
params.[].accessRules.consoleAccessAllowed | Y | Boolean | 콘솔 접근 허용 여부 | |
params.[].accessRules.apiAccessAllowed | Y | Boolean | API 접근 허용 여부 |
- 최대 생성 개수는 100개입니다
응답
응답 바디
[{
"id": "String",
"nrn": "String",
"name": "String",
"success" : "boolean"
}]
파라미터 | 타입 | 설명 | 제약사항 |
---|---|---|---|
[].id | String | 생성된 유저 아이디 | |
[].nrn | String | 생성된 유저 nrn | |
[].name | String | 생성된 유저 로그인 아이디 | |
[].success | Boolean | 성공 여부 | |
[].message | String | 실패 시 오류 메시지 |
에러
아래 에러 코드는 이 액션(Action)에서 특징적으로 발생하는 에러입니다. 에러 응답 형식은 Error Response를 참고해 주십시오.
공통적으로 발생하는 에러에 대한 상세한 설명은 NAVER Cloud Platform API를 참조해 주십시오.
HTTP status code | 에러 코드 | 에러 메시지 |
---|---|---|
400 | 400 | 잘못된 요청입니다. |
이 문서가 도움이 되었습니까?